Sticking with a Good Thing – Sustainability as the Market Shifts

Print Article Print Article

By Maria Patterson

RISMEDIA, April 21, 2008-Being the regional director for Watson Realty’s Central Florida territory is no small task. For Ken Bennett, who bears the title and oversees 14 offices and 675 sales associates from Disney World to Port Orange, staying successful has meant changing with the times and also sticking with what works- such as virtual tours from Obeo.

Market conditions in Central Florida, according to Bennett, are mixed. “We have some pockets that are stable and some areas that are declining,” he says. “We enjoyed great appreciation in many metro areas in the boom years; the ones that escalated the fastest are now bearing the brunt of adjusting back to normal market values.”

That said, Watson Realty has managed to maintain a favorable level of success and market share. Bennett attributes this phenomenon to the positive energy from company leader Bill Watson.

“He’s the most upbeat man I’ve ever seen,” says Bennett. “The attitude of the person at the top always filters down. We feel that there isn’t anything we can’t accomplish in this market or any market. We have to get our associates focused on the fact that in order to achieve a level of success comparable to what they’ve experienced in the past, we have to be more aggressive with our marketing and in improving our skill sets. Our market share is increasing in many areas, so it appears to be working.”
